Altamont offers open horizons, friendly neighbors, and an easy pace in the heart of Duchesne County. Residents prize its small-town feel and practical conveniences, with everyday errands handled locally and larger shopping and services a short drive away in Roosevelt and Duchesne. Weekends tend to fill with rodeos, school events, and backyard barbecues, all framed by wide skies and mountain views.
Families appreciate the strong school community and the room kids have to roam. Outdoor enthusiasts find an impressive backyard: boating and beach time at Starvation State Park, with year-round access to water and trails through the official Starvation State Park site; cool alpine air, camping, and trailheads in the nearby Ashley National Forest; and classic high-country escapes at Moon Lake via the Ashley National Forest’s official resources. Day trips expand the map to fossil beds and canyon drives at Dinosaur National Monument through the National Park Service, while the Bureau of Land Management’s Vernal Field Office offers guidance on off‑highway routes, wildlife viewing, and dispersed camping.
For higher education and upskilling, Utah State University Uintah Basin and Uintah Basin Technical College provide local pathways to degrees and in-demand certifications. Healthcare needs are well served by Uintah Basin Healthcare’s clinics and hospital network.
